Farrari 4 Posted November 4, 2014 Share Posted November 4, 2014 Assuming it is a standard BT jack you will need to connect the wires to terminals 2 and 5 as otto said. You will need a push on tool to do so. Don't be tempted to use a screw drivr as it will splay the terminals. The tool is reasonably cheap to buy at any home electronic shop.
